I have been flying in Brazil with GOL, TAM and Webjet... But never have I succeeded to buy my ticket online!

I have a Swiss Mastercard, Swiss Visa card. Since this month I have a CPF number...

1. flight (GOL):
    I couldn't buy online without CPF
    I went to desk in airport
    They didn't accept my Mastercard (actually they charged it 6 times until it got blocked)
    I went to ATM to get cash and pay

2. flight (tried GOL/TAM)
    I still didn't have CPF, so GOL failed online
    TAM online didn't accept credit card (Mastercard)
    I bought Webjet ticket with cash in tourist office

3. flight (received CPF number, tried GOL/TAM)
    GOL website said, my CPF birth date was incorrect... !?
    TAM online didn't accept my credit cards (Mastercard and Visa) without telling me why
    (Thanks Hans for helping me!)

In December I'll be back in Brazil and would like to buy some tickets in advance...
So I have some questions:
    How do you fly in Brazil/buy tickets? (They told me it's more expensive to buy the ticket in the office - which makes sense...)
    What about cheap flights? I heard people saying they flew for 1R$, but I never found a flight for a price like that... How?
    Is it possible that they registered my CPF with a wrong birth date? (How) can I check/change this from Switzerland? Or is it maybe that it takes some time until the CPF is valid (Somehow you can confirm the CPF on the website of Receita Federal, which seemed to be ok.)
